Yes, AIIMS Bhubaneswar MBBS Admission is based on NEET UG Score. The candidates need to appear for NEET UG Counseling after getting a valid NEET Score.
If you belong to General Category, you should aim for at least 675 (680+ is recommended) and if you belong to any Reserved Categories (OBC/ST/SC), you need to score at least 650 to secure a seat for MBBS at AIIMS.

Some medical field which offer best work and life balance are shown below -
Dentistry (BDS & MDS) – Fixed clinic hours, fewer emergencies.
Pharmacy (BPharm & MPharm) – Less stress compared to hospital-based jobs.
Physiotherapy (BPT & MPT) – Flexible working hours, minimal emergency calls.
Public Health & Community Medicine – Focus on preventive healthcare rather than emergency treatments.
Clinical Research & Medical Writing – Research-based work with no direct patient responsibilities.

ABSMARI by Abhinav Bindra facilitate students by the medium of several tie-ups and collaborations. The Insitute recently partnered with IISM to provide two new certification courses. Similarly, ABSMARI collaborated with Singapore Heart Foundation and Nursing Home, Singapore, to organise a workshop on 'Optimizing Exercise for Cardiac Patients'. Apart from this, the Abhinav Bindra Sports Medicine and Research Institute also conducts various seminars that provides insights on any particular subject. Several collaborations and tie-ups provide a platform to have hands-on experience and field work for the students.
